✦ Synopsis


Recent studies of bilayer two-dimensional electron systems in GaAs/AlGaAs double auantum wells are reviewed.

After describing a techniaue for making seuarate connections to the individual 2D layers, three cl&ses of experiments will bi ouilined: "drag" studies of interlaver electron-electron interactions, 2D-2D resonant tunneling exp&iments, and lastly,-a new method for determining the compressibility of thk interacting 2D electron gas. As a final example of the new physics afforded by bilayer 2D systems, the recent discovery of a new fractional quantum Hall state, not found in single layer systems, will be discussed.
